World at War Again Empty World at War Again

Post  mikeschultz Sun Dec 30 2012, 11:24

Thinking long on the plight of all of mankind,
And womanhood, in a world gone crazy,
Chaos, I step back and take a wide view,
And see there, there in the midst of it all,
A dust devil with a burned tumbleweed
In its maw, a torch raised up in vain hopes
One will see it and come to teach, learn, and
Try to understand. Each soul seeks its way,
Waiting for other signs of God’s presence.
“Dust Devil,” I ask, “What have you been at?”
Searching yards and woods for a burning bush.’

No fear for an older vernacular,
We face the chaos and spit our curses
At the wind, and they are blown back at us.
Where is peace? Where is the calm for living?
Where, oh WHERE! “Where have all the flowers gone?”
I, too, would pick a bundle of flowers,
A gift of nature and my small efforts,
Tokens shy of their full depths of meaning.
As matters of species more than gender,
We are more alike than we care to know,
Chaos. Step back and take a wider view.


Michael Schultz © December 28, 2012 (1835)
